Travel is forecasted to grow at an average of 5.8% a year through 2032. That's more than double the expected growth rate of the overall economy (2.7% a year). ✈️ Here's how digital technology and AI are empowering the industry to reimagine the travel experience and unlock long-term growth. https://mck.co/3TrKnC4 #NeverJustTech

🌍✈️ Unpacking 2024 #ravel #Trends: An Expedia Group Insight 🌟 Are you curious about the hottest travel trends for 2024? The latest "Unpack '24" report from Expedia Group unveils a world of exciting possibilities: 🌟 Fun Facts from Expedia Group's "Unpack '24" Report 🌟 1. #Setjetting: Over 50% of travelers now take their travel cues from TV shows and movies, more than Instagram, TikTok, and podcasts combined! So, get ready to visit destinations that have graced your favorite screens. 2. Dupes: Travelers are embracing "dupes" – affordable alternatives to popular hotspots. These places are not just easier on the wallet but often less crowded and equally delightful. For example, instead of packed Santorini how about Paros? Picture perfect but much less crowded. Or instead of bustling Geneva, consider visiting Quebec City for a similar European charm without the crowds. 3. Tour Tourism: The "Swiftie effect" and world domination by music stars like Beyoncé are taking live music tourism to new heights. Concerts are now a solid reason to travel, and it's not just about the music, but the unique experiences that come with it. 4. Dry Tripping: More than 40% of travelers are keen to book detox trips with alcohol-free options like mocktails. 5. Vibes Matter: The "vibe" of a hotel is big in 2024, with reviews mentioning it skyrocketing by 1,090%. More than 90% of travelers say it's an important factor when choosing where to stay. (my 10 years old daughter always asks me about the vibe of a place) 6. Trending Hotels: Travelers are loving traditional Japanese inns (ryokans) and Moroccan riads, with searches for these charming accommodations seeing a remarkable increase. 7. Go-ccasions: Beyond typical celebrations, travelers are finding more reasons to hit the road, from "puppymoons" to "first-date-iversaries." Work-related milestones are also becoming travel catalysts. 8. Outdoor Amenities: Outdoor features like hot tubs, fire pits, and sports facilities are hot commodities for holiday homes. 9. Trending Vrbo Vacation Homes: Converted mills, barns, and farms are the places to be in 2024. Expect fresh produce, cute animals, and cozy retreats in these countryside properties. 10. Gen Gen AI: Generative AI is becoming a traveler's best friend. It's not just about chatbots; it's now integrated into travel planning, from finding hotels to comparing flights and gaining inspiration for your next adventure.
